The Cultural Advisory Council

“Wisdom comes in many forms.”

We have established a Cultural Advisory Council (CAC) — a group of respected community voices guiding the cultural dimensions of our work. The table reflects the full richness of our community: elders, cultural practitioners, religious leaders, artists, and advocates.

  • ✓ Bringing deep cultural knowledge and lived experience.
  • ✓ Ensuring decisions are genuinely connected to the community.
  • ✓ Outspoken champions of diversity and inclusion.

Governance & Transparency

We are a registered Not-for-Profit incorporated under the Associations Incorporation Act 2009 (NSW). Every dollar we earn is used to advance our purposes.

We maintain clear records and make our financial statements and Constitution available to our members.

The committee makes day-to-day decisions. Significant changes to our rules require a special resolution (75% agreement) by members at a general meeting with 14 days’ notice.

We can raise money through fees, donations, grants, and cultural partnerships. The Treasurer oversees day-to-day finances, and if annual revenue exceeds $500,000, we undertake independent audits.

Everyone is expected to act with honesty, integrity, and respect for the cultures that make our community who we are. Conflicts of interest must be disclosed. We do not tolerate actions that bring the association into disrepute.
